The tulip touch, by anne fine, is about a girl called natalie who starts at a new school after a change in her fathers job causes her family to move. The tulip touch by anne fine won the whitbread childrens book award in 1996. The book raises questions of morality and accountability, as well as exploring the question of nature versus nurture. Its an elemental friendship story, told by a good girl, natalie, who follows a dangerous outsider, tulip, into flaming trouble. Exploring the countryside around the elegant old hotel her father is now managing, natalie first sees tulip standing in a field holding a kitten.
